Comprehending Conservatory Leaks
Conservatory leaks can occur due to various factors, and understanding these causes is crucial for reliable repair. Here are some of the most common issues:
Roof Issues: The roof is the most susceptible part of a conservatory. Issues such as damaged or missing tiles, loose or scrubby seals, and poorly installed flashing can all cause water ingress.Window and Door Seals: Over time, the seals around windows and doors can deteriorate, enabling water to seep in. Before trying any repairs, it's vital to accurately determine the source of the leak. Here are some actions to assist you identify the issue:
Visual Inspection: Start by aesthetically checking the conservatory from both the within and outside. Search for indications of water damage, such as wet spots, stains, or mold.Water Test: Conduct a water test by utilizing a hose pipe or a container of water to simulate rain. Concentrate on areas where leaks are thought and observe where water goes into.Inspect Seals and Joints: Examine the seals around windows, doors, and roof joints. Try to find gaps, fractures, or locations where the sealant has actually deteriorated.Check Gutters and Downspouts: Ensure that rain gutters and downspouts are clear of particles and correctly linked. Once you have identified the source of the leak, you can continue with the essential repairs. Here is a detailed guide to help you fix common conservatory leaks:

Prepare the Area
Safety First: Ensure you have the needed safety equipment, such as gloves, goggles, and a ladder if needed.Clear the Area: Remove any furniture or products that might be damaged during the repair procedure.
Fix Roof Leaks
Check and Replace Damaged Tiles: Identify and replace any broken or missing tiles. Ensure they are safely secured.Reapply Sealant: Apply a top quality sealant to any spaces or fractures in the roof. Use a silicone-based sealant for best results.Check and Repair Flashing: Ensure that the flashing around chimneys, vents, and other protrusions is correctly set up and sealed.
Repair Window and Door Seals
Eliminate Old Sealant: Use a scraper or an utility knife to remove any old, abject sealant.Tidy the Area: Clean the area with a damp cloth to get rid of any dirt or debris.Apply New Sealant: Apply a brand-new, high-quality sealant around the windows and doors. Guarantee it is smooth and even.
Clear Gutters and Downspouts
Get rid of Debris: Use a trowel or a garden tube to remove any leaves, branches, or other particles from the seamless gutters.Check Connections: Ensure that all connections are secure which water flows freely through the downspouts.Set Up Gutter Guards: Consider installing seamless gutter guards to prevent future clogs.
Address Structural Issues
Examine for Cracks: Look for any cracks in the walls or foundation. Use a flashlight to get a much better view.Repair Cracks: Use a concrete patching compound to fill any fractures. Follow the maker's guidelines for application and drying time.Seal the Area: Apply a water resistant sealant over the fixed area to prevent water from seeping in.
Enhance Drainage
